Sensory bases of metaphorical representations of immaterial objects (time, quantity, speech) in the discourse of the dialect language personality

The paper continues to develop the linguistic personology issues, in particular, the study of the linguistic world of a specific language personality on the basis of its discursive practices. The object of the research is the language personality of V.P. Vershinina (1909 - 2004), a resident of Vershinino Village of Tomsk Region, a traditional speech culture representative. The attention is focused on the description of the processes of figurative representations of immaterial objects, which is based on different types of reconsideration of perceptual characteristics. The abstract names related to the conceptual domains "time", "quantity", and "speech". The analysis shows that time in the discursive practices of the language personality is interpreted as the material and sensually perceived form of the being inextricably linked with the person and interpreted by means of spatial categories, activating primarily visual, but also audio, gustatory, and tactile analyzers. The abstract notion of quantity in the discourse of the language personality is explicated materially and represented by comparison with physical objects that have size, shape, volume, sometimes length, that can be seen. Figurative representation of speech is based on rethinking of all kinds of perception, in which visual, audio, and tactile perception dominates. The analysis of the material allowed to make some generalizations. The most common regularity in the interpretation of immaterial objects by the language personality is their figurative representation through their materialization, in particular, objectification when they are given properties to be perceived by the human senses. All kinds of sensory perception are involved in metaphorical specification of abstract categories: one can see, hear, touch, taste, feel the shape, size, volume and nature of the surface of intangible objects. The most popular way of objectification is their visual representation, which is not surprising, as the largest part of information about the world comes to people via sight. In visual perception the spatial parameter is particularly accentuated, which, according to our observations, dominates not only in the abstract, but is the most versatile method of figurative representation of any object or action, too. Active use of primary sensory characteristics in the imagery reflection of the world is quite natural for a traditional culture representative: the speaker does not use complex associations in the creation of an image, referring to the primary perceptual experience, relying on the traditional, familiar, often used in everyday life. The described methods of verbalizing ideas about immaterial objects are a reflection of the collective experience of the peasant society, but they also show the creativity of a language personality.
